Exactly How bid Bonds Work: The Process Explained
When you determine to place a bid on a building and construction project, recognizing how bid bonds job is essential for your success.
Initially, website link 'll require to acquire a bid bond from a surety company, which functions as an assurance that you'll fulfill your commitments if granted the contract. You'll normally pay a premium based on the complete bid amount.
As soon as you send your bid, the bond guarantees the task proprietor that if you fail to honor your bid, the surety will certainly cover the costs, as much as the bond's limitation.
If you win the contract, the bid bond is often changed by a performance bond. This procedure aids shield the rate of interests of all parties included and ensures that you're serious about your proposition.
